diff options
author | Bram Moolenaar <Bram@vim.org> | 2013-07-03 14:19:54 +0200 |
---|---|---|
committer | Bram Moolenaar <Bram@vim.org> | 2013-07-03 14:19:54 +0200 |
commit | caf2dffd5142f93c75367e3af99e52df7abf73cd (patch) | |
tree | 122538c2eb69f2e70f43be6c9bf419b42c9e404a | |
parent | 5e6d5ca16c8d35abd28fdeb7f2600ce5e8aeacc1 (diff) | |
download | vim-git-caf2dffd5142f93c75367e3af99e52df7abf73cd.tar.gz |
updated for version 7.3.1293v7.3.1293
Problem: Put in empty buffer cannot be undone.
Solution: Save one more line for undo. (Ozaki)
-rw-r--r-- | src/ops.c | 2 | ||||
-rw-r--r-- | src/version.c | 2 |
2 files changed, 3 insertions, 1 deletions
@@ -3499,7 +3499,7 @@ do_put(regname, dir, count, flags) ++lnum; /* In an empty buffer the empty line is going to be replaced, include * it in the saved lines. */ - if ((bufempty() ? u_save(0, 1) : u_save(lnum - 1, lnum)) == FAIL) + if ((bufempty() ? u_save(0, 2) : u_save(lnum - 1, lnum)) == FAIL) goto end; #ifdef FEAT_FOLDING if (dir == FORWARD) diff --git a/src/version.c b/src/version.c index d661c6436..e03d81b06 100644 --- a/src/version.c +++ b/src/version.c @@ -729,6 +729,8 @@ static char *(features[]) = static int included_patches[] = { /* Add new patch number below this line */ /**/ + 1293, +/**/ 1292, /**/ 1291, |